( Sorry no pictures yet!) It just so happened by shear
coincidence on my part that I had to be in Heber Springs,
Arkansas on Friday August 11th for business purposes. Therefore,
another act of pure coincidence followed with the result being a
guided fly fishing trip on Saturday the 12th on the Little Red
River. The end result was a fantastic fishing day! A friend of
mine and I ended catching and releasing at least 55-60 beautiful
rainbows all on fly rod. The 3 largest were all on the 18 inch
mark and both of us lost larger ! Technique was drifting
dropper rig under indicators ( told the guide it was a vosi --
got a strange look ) with a size 14 on top with a bead head
midge on the bottom size 18 and a 5x fluoro tippet. The guide
was Greg Seaton @ Little Red River Fly Fishing Guide Service ---
very knowledgeable, did a very good job. If anyone is interested

First time fishing the little red river...Great fun chasing
fresh water trout! I fly fished when I was a kid, and then in
Colorado many years ago, I just got into fly fishing again and
just got back October 28th 2018 from a week fly fishing along
the little red river, all wading with no guide in between dam
water releases....... caught about 15 nice size 18" rainbows,
but the days I fished it was raining all day..... the 24"
rainbows were jumping 2 f.t out of the water 10 ft. out of my
casting range..... they were feeding on adult midges on the
surface, I caught most on midge pupa, and emergers.... I down
loaded a power plant release schedule which worked perfect.... I
want to return and fly fish some of the other shoals with public
access...I drove my sprinter camper and stayed at the Corp John
F Kennedy camp ground at the base of the dam, which is first
come first served this time of year....... I want to try Beaver
dam 125miles north of the little red river also, and possible
Norfork dam areas in the future.

I know the generation schedules are a must !( I have it on my
smart phone ) for fishing any of the Arkansas tail waters. I
plan my trips around the generation amounts. ( No fish biting at
Generations )I want to try the beaver Dam tail water ...rainbows
only but less traffic then Norfork, Bull shoals, or the little
red.....same corps type of camp grounds. Course The little red
has great fall Browns migration ....my next trip to the little
red I will bring a screen type tent to place at my campground
site and drive my Mercedes pleasure way sprinter to fish down
river shoals, being the campground is first come first served
..( if I leave someone would take my spot without a tent on
site. ) people in the know drive to down stream shoals, I want
to fish Libby shoals, Parking and a long ripply shoal, where a
lot of nice fish are caught .......My pleasure way sprinter
makes a nice place to retreat for lunch or hot coffee and heater
to warm up without coming back to the camp ground ! (
www.swpa.gov ) this will give you all the Arkansas tail water
generation schedules for all tail water mentioned above.
